首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Cytoscape不会从我的点文件加载node和edge属性

Cytoscape是一种用于可视化和分析网络的开源软件平台。它提供了丰富的功能和工具,可以帮助用户可视化和分析复杂的网络结构。

对于Cytoscape不会从点文件加载节点和边属性的问题,可能是由于以下几个原因导致的:

  1. 文件格式不正确:首先,确保你的点文件(通常是以.txt或.csv格式保存的)符合Cytoscape所支持的格式要求。Cytoscape支持多种文件格式,如SIF、XGMML、GML等。你可以参考Cytoscape官方文档中关于文件格式的说明,确保你的文件格式正确无误。
  2. 属性列未正确定义:在点文件中,节点和边的属性通常以列的形式进行定义。确保你的点文件中包含了正确的列定义,并且每个节点和边的属性都在相应的列中进行了正确的填写。你可以使用文本编辑器或电子表格软件(如Excel)来查看和编辑你的点文件,确保属性列的定义和填写正确。
  3. 加载设置错误:在Cytoscape中,加载网络文件时需要进行一些设置。确保你在加载点文件时选择了正确的文件格式,并且设置了正确的节点和边属性列。你可以在Cytoscape的菜单或工具栏中找到相应的加载选项,并根据你的文件格式和属性列进行设置。

如果你仍然遇到问题,可以参考Cytoscape的官方文档、用户手册或在线社区,寻求更详细的帮助和支持。此外,腾讯云也提供了一些与网络可视化和分析相关的产品和服务,例如腾讯云图数据库、腾讯云数据分析等,你可以根据具体需求选择适合的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Cytoscape中文教程(3)

nodesedge不会被移除了。...如果所有的支持一个edge句子都被删除,这个edge也会网络中被删除。 (x)用户可以通过右击node来扩充网络。...一旦被储存,就可以在file下被加载。 14.注释属性表达数据 可选择步骤:额外nodeedge属性文件可以被整合进你网络。(box3) 15表达数据文件有一定格式。...否则,依然遵从box3也就是14.下面详细说下这种属性文件建立方法 为了输入属性文件表达数据文件cytoscape,基因或蛋白标识符必须cytoscapenodeID(或其他cytoscape...如果没有匹配标识,可以通过加载另外标识文件作为新node属性。现在介绍一种方法来建立和加载标识匹配属性。我们将使用一个教Synergizer外部ID匹配服务,这是有哈佛大学Roth实验室提供

3.7K118

Cytoscape中文教程(2)

cytoscape可以读取这些text文件,并且他们建立网络,想获取更多细节,请阅读creating network部分。 8.nodeedge列数据 相互作用网络作为独立模型是非常有用。...但是,但是他们其他信息整合时候对解决科学问题是极其有力Cytoscape允许用户添加任意nodeedge网络信作为nodeedge网络数据列,添加到cytoscape。...8.2 legacy cytoscape 属性格式 除了表格数据,当前cytoscape版本仍然可以使用之前一些文件格式。...Nodeedge数据列属于noesedge,所以也是独立于网络。给定nodeedge数据值会被应用于这些nodeedge所有的复制本,不管这个数据文件或网络文件是否第一次输入。...Cytoscape2.4现在有一个加强GUI来家长本体论相联系注释,允许你本地或远程加载. 9.1本体论注释文件格式 Cytoscape本体论服务标准文件格式是OBOgene association

4.9K30

前端数据可视化之 --- (一)亿级关系图

echarts应该是实现不了了(也可能是对echarts属性研究不深),D3?...(D3是肯定可以了),与其用D3从零开始为什么不找到现有的开源专门做关系图库,来实现它,百度了半天也没搜出个一支半截,最终还是看了某查网,发现它们引入了一个叫cytoscape.js文件,百度了一下...:[ { selector:'node',//样式,同理还有边"edge",也可以新增一个类名,然后在事件里面addremove来改变样式...node", function (a) { //监听鼠标左键释放}) //线: //同理线事件将‘node’换成‘edge’就行了 这里个人感觉,有了.neighborhood("node/edge"...因为目前国内使用cytoscape很少,论坛上也没有多少资源,期待大家在使用之后能回到此处在做交流,遇到这些问题你是否也遇到了,如何解决我们可以做一些探讨。

3.8K21

cytoscape中文手册推荐(配视频)

网络互动分享: Cytoscape允许用户对网络图进行交互操作,如放大、缩小、拖动节点等。用户还可以保存网络图为图像或特定格式文件,以便与同事共享研究结果。...另外推荐一个一个稍微复杂一示范代码,展示如何使用RCy3在R中进行更多功能操作,包括添加节点属性、样式设置、导出图像等: library(RCy3) # 创建一个Cytoscape会话 cy <...1") ) for (edge in edges) { createEdge(network, source = edge[1], target = edge[2]) } # 设置节点属性 nodeData...条边网络图,设置了节点属性样式,最后使用“force-directed”布局算法对网络进行布局,并将结果传递给Cytoscape进行可视化。...将WGCNA模块信息导出为CSV文件,其中包括每个节点名称所属模块。 在Cytoscape中导入你基因网络数据,创建节点边。

58562

Cytoscape之操作界面介绍

Cytoscape核心是网络(图),其中节点(node)是基因、蛋白质或分子,其中连接则是这些生物结构之间相互作用。...第二步 安装Cytoscape软件 Cytocapehttp://cytoscape.org 网站上下载,无论LinuxWindows都可以简单安装。...这些功能可通过菜单找到 网络处理面板(顶部左边板块),它包含可选择整个网络窗口(底部左边) 网络主视图窗口,展示网络 属性浏览板块(底部板块),展示选择或边属性能够修改属性值。...style 属性 style - node style 中 node 面板是针对网络中点属性操作,主要包括:形状、颜色、大小;边界线类型、颜色、宽度;标签颜色、大小;背景色透明度等等...2.style - edge style 中 edge 面板是针对网络中边属性操作,主要包括:边类型、颜色、宽度;连接源、目标处箭头类型等等。 ?

3.2K101

网络图探寻基因互作蛛丝马迹(4)

在前面的3期中,我们给大家讲解了网络图构造、 STRING数据库Cytoscape软件安装,链接如下: 网络图探寻基因互作蛛丝马迹(1) 【科研猫·绘图】网络图探寻基因互作蛛丝马迹(2)...,第一列是Source Node,第二列是Target Node; 就拿我们STRING生成网络图源文件为例,我们生成是一个名为string_interactions.tsv文件,这是一个文本文件...点击导入文件,找到你网络源文件,也就是我们这里 string_interactions.tsv 文件,导入之后是这样,软件会自动帮我们识别最重要两列:Source node Target node...除了Source Node、Target Node,其他列数据属性还包括Interaction Type、Edge Attribution、Source Attribution、Target Attribution...(3) Select: 筛选,即从整个网络图当中按照用户要求去选定特Node或者Edge。这个功能用也是比较多

89820

RNA-seq入门实战(十):PPI蛋白互作网络构建(下)——Cytoscape软件使用

大家开始根据我ngs组学视频进行一系列公共数据集分析实战,其中几个小伙伴让非常惊喜,不需要怎么沟通指导,就默默完成了一个实战!...Cytoscape还可以使用Apps实现一些附加功能,大多数Apps可以免费Cytoscape应用程序商店获取。 Cytoscape 2....此时也可以在导入节点信息后,继续添加其他注释信息,下面示范添加基因上下调信息到Cytoscape软件中 基因上下调注释信息获取 差异分析结果文件中获取基因名与上下调信息,并命名为“node1”、“log2FC...nodeedge相关调整设置在软件左侧Style处,Style下方可切换nodeedge等设置: 注意,相关设置左上property处可以打开或隐藏可调整选项 下面示范根据degree...,调整好其在画布上位置大小(否则导出图像容易不完整),在画布下方点击文件导出键,一般选择保存为pdf文件便于后期在进行编辑 ---- 4.

2.8K63

Cytoscape中文教程(1)

写在前面,这个教程真的有点长,是早期翻译,如果你完全不懂Cytoscape,那么你读这些,应该会做出非常漂亮各种基于cytoscape及插件图,因为这个教程真的很白。...原文地址 ---- 直接第三部分开始 3 命令行参数 Cytoscape可以识别很多可选命令行参数,包括network,节点,边和会话文件等数据文件运行规范,这些文件是可以输出(有h或help flag...有一些网络非常大(几千个节点边),这就需要很长时间显示。因为这个原因,cytoscape网络或许没有一个view。有视图网络有正常黑色字体,并且网络不会有高亮红色。...下面是一个table file 样品。 ? image.png Network table file应该至少包含两列才能产生有edge网络。如果文件只有一列,产生网络将不会有任何边。...想从这个表输入节点列,请参看Nods and edge column data部分http://manual.cytoscape.org/en/3.4.0/Node_and_Edge_Column_Data.html

10.5K42

R绘制网络图

对于网络图,其实我们并不陌生,用比较普遍Cytoscape这个软件。不过,我们今天主角是R包---igragh。...相比Cytoscape,igragh便利之处就是你不用趴在电脑上很痛苦去一一调整节点大小,颜色等属性。接下来,就开启小白学习之旅了。...一、安装并加载所需R包 install.packages("igraph") library(igraph) 二、使用方法 对于图 graph 这种数据结构而言,最基本元素包括节点(node 边...(默认值为0,标签以顶点为中心) vertex.label.degree 标签相对于顶点位置, (0,pi,pi/2,-pi/2分别表示有,左,下上) EDGES edge.color 边颜色...()函数,文件中读取network数据(读取文件方式就是常规数据读取方式,read.table 或 read.csv等) #示例数据: 左右滑动查看完整内容 ?

1.8K20

Enrichment Map User guide用户指南

假如你富集结果GSEA产生,主要从你结果文件夹选择正确文件即可,如果是用其他方法产生富集结果,那你就去看下面的Full user guide,file 格式部分,确保文件格式EM匹配。...高级提示 1.对于大网络低放大水平cytoscape会自动减少这个细节(比如隐藏节点标签,不显示node边界0.若override(手动操作?无视?)...这可以参考cytoscape手册 3.如果你使用是GSEAs MSigDb,那么你可以为每个基因集获取额外信息,方法是添加一个额外属性(edit-preferences-properties-add-enter...3.第二个rpt文件可以dataset2加载。...不能小于建网时定义值。 6.在浏览器加载GSEA结果 7.建立EM时参数列表 8.热图自动聚焦默认是选中。当你选中网络中任何nodeedge,EM自动更新表达视图。

2K30

网络图探寻基因互作蛛丝马迹(1)

网络图是一种图解模型,形状如同网络,故称为网络图,它由节点(node连线(edge)两个因素组成。其中node又分为source node(源节点)target node(目标节点)。...这里node就是我们基因,edge就是基因间相互作用关系。任何网络图都不外乎这些构成成分。知道了网络图构成之后,再做图做分析就很简单了。...因为,基因数少了,网络图中edge太少,图做不出来,或者做出来很丑;而基因数多了,网络图太大,导致没办法导入软件中进行分析,耗时太久,同时背景噪声混杂影响也会更多。...因此,个人一般建议要分析网络图基因数量在50-300个左右,这样网络图比较适中,不会太大,也不会太小。 连线(edge) 所谓edge就是基因之间相互作用关系。...那么,我们分析步骤也就一目了然了: Step1: 基因列表 到 基因互作 Step2: 基因互作 到 互作网络 Step3: 互作网络 到 关键基因 先给大家看看我们分析结果,后面的教程中

1.6K40

抽象:如何概念定义中提取模型?

Node 可以用 Dot ( Circle (圆圈)形状来表示。 Edge 可以用 Line (线) Curve(曲线)来表示。...这里 Dot Circle 可以用 Shape 来进行抽象,而 Line Curve 在实例画之后,就是一系列 Points()。...在这里,我们又进一步展开了 Node Edge 定义: Node 通常是带有标签,这里标签通常是指文本。 Edge 除了 Line ,还可以带有箭头(arrow),即它是有方向性。...缩放 等 而定义上,我们会发现颜色、材质等属性,似乎不应该放在 Shape 中。那么,我们是否需要一些额外概念来放置它们呢?...在这时,就会有 Node Properties  Edge Properties。在构建了基本模型之后,就可以将模型可视化出来 。

1.9K10

🤠 Network | 高颜值动态网络可视化工具(二)

创建网络文件 用到函数是tbl_graph,方便大家tibble或data frame格式文件进行网络创建。...修改网络文件 有时候我们会想修改已经建好网络文件, 可以使用activate函数单独进行nodes文件或edges文件修改。 这里我们将edges文件weight以降序进行排列。...---- 6.2 加上文字图例 ggraph(routes_tidy, layout = "graphopt") + geom_node_point() + geom_edge_link(...动态交互网络 有时候我们会想做个交互网络,像Cytoscape软件一样实现单个节点拖拽、排列等。 这里我们可以使用visNetwork networkD3实现动态、交互网络绘制。...visNetworkedges属性并不能通过scale进行缩放,所以我们先手动调整一下edges宽度。

69310

如何构建一个在线绘图工具:Feakin 是如何设计与构建

直到最近,重新燃起了一兴趣: 架构治理工具 ArchGuard 依赖于「图即代码」,用于生成架构图,以更好进行架构治理。...在它图形模型里,Node(节点) Edge(边) 形式上都算是 Element,然后在渲染时根据图形类型展开。于是在渲染时,直接采用 HTML5 里 Canvas 进行绘制即可。...Excalidraw 对来说,其最有意思是引入了射影几何,来进行节点变化时,自动 Edge 跟踪;即当 A B 左边移动到右边时,对应线自动连接到 B 右边边上。...即对图形建模,理清 Diagram/Graph、NodeEdge、Shape、Element 之间关系,并包含基本图形表示关系。 图形绘制。...主要包含(Point),可以用于构建普通直线、贝塞尔曲线(Bézier)曲线等,还有 属性(Props)。

1.5K30

cytoscape十大插件之--cytoHubba插件

下面是cytoscape讲师笔记 一、软件下载 cytoscape 毋庸置疑是最出名网络可视化神器,过万引用率是最强大口碑,它支持网络种类很多。...,简单说一下,官网有个下载地址:http://apps.cytoscape.org/ 调用浏览器下载jar文件,但是需要自己移动到cytoscapeAPP目录: mv ~/Downloads/cluego-plugin...cytoHubba根据nodes在网络中属性进行排名。...1、左边列表点击style 2、下方针对调整对象进行选择,Node:节点;Edge:边 3、需要点击Edge color to arrows才可以进行调整 ?...4、如果是需要选择/删除/隐藏所有节点或者边时,可通过菜单栏Select进行选择 ? ? 5、这里就可以通过点击LabelLine Type中Remove Bypass删除数字虚线 ?

18.7K94

基于networkx分析Louvain算法社团网络划分

(称为边)构成,V、E分别计G集合边集合。...在图概念中,空间位置,边区直长短都无关紧要,重要是其中有几个以及那些之间有变相连。  图1:图示例  2有向图无向图 最基本图通常被定义为“无向图”,与之对应则被称为“有向图”。...不会来来回回绕圈子、不会重复经过同一个同一条边路线,就是一条“路径”,这些路径中经过顶点最少那个路径就是最短路径。  6图简单路径 如果路径上各顶点均不互相重复,称这样路径为简单路径。...图显示还有两个比较好用工具就是CytoscapeGephi也比较好用,显示图像方便又美观,其中Cytoscape可以读取CSV文件,可以对图进行拖拽。感兴趣朋友可以研究一下。 ...2求图常用属性    读取CSV文件获取图边集合列表 部分原始数据如图:    计算图各种属性整体图,看到所有人都是有联系,由于人物比较多,所以图显示不出具体效果。

3.4K30

cytoscapecytohubba及MCODE插件寻找子网络hub基因

特别不喜欢写网页工具或者鼠标点点点软件操作指南,因为感觉就跟QQ软件一样,自己摸索就ok了,所以我cytoscape十讲就一直处于施工阶段: Cytoscape十讲之网络图认知 Cytoscape...不过,好在有一千多学员,一百多个学徒,给他们安排作业就是写这些简单软件操作指南,这样就弥补了写不来太基础教程弱点。...这里有一个值得注意,一个基因可以既是source node又是target node,甚至可以同时是source nodetarget node(没见过不管)。...6,可以看出来这是一个属性文件,记录了基因属性,也就是节点各种属性,列名中进一步可以看到gal1,gal4,gal80,经查询后得知这是3种酵母转录因子,猜测每一行就是一个基因关gal1,gal4,...这些流程视频教程都在B站GitHub了,目录如下: 第一讲:GEO,表达芯片与R 第二讲:GEO下载数据得到表达量矩阵 第三讲:对表达量矩阵用GSEA软件做分析 第四讲:根据分组信息做差异分析 第五讲

20.9K55
领券